(Baonghean.vn) - With the spirit of solidarity and mutual love, the units, forces and people of Nghe An have united, accompanied, "shared the fire" with the frontline, adding strength to soon repel the Covid-19 epidemic.

Immediately after translationCovid-19After the outbreak in Ha Tinh (June 5), not afraid of difficulties and dangers, Nghe An province sent 52 cadres, doctors, nurses and equipment to support the neighboring province, with the spirit of determination to do their best to complete the task, to help the neighboring province to soon contain the epidemic in the shortest time.

June 13, in the areaVinh cityThe first case of infection appeared in the community, since then the number of Covid-19 cases has increased, the number of locations that have to be locked down has increased, the frontline forces against the epidemic have to work hard, sometimes exhausted after many consecutive sleepless nights of tracing and testing. Police officers, soldiers, militia, and civil defense forces always have to "strain themselves" to be on duty at medical checkpoints, locked down areas, and roads leading to and from the city to ensure security, order and social safety.

In particular, among the hearts sent to the front line against the epidemic, there are also children who use their savings to support the work of preventing and fighting the Covid-19 epidemic, such as Nguyen Tran Minh Anh in block 11, Ha Huy Tap ward, Vinh city, who donated all of his savings to support the Vinh city Covid-19 Prevention and Control Fund with the amount of 100,000,000 VND, with the desire to do meaningful work to encourage doctors, nurses and local authorities. Mrs. Tran Thi Nhung (100 years old) in hamlet 6, Quynh Lam commune, Quynh Luu district, used a cane to go to the village Cultural House to support the work of preventing and fighting the Covid-19 epidemic, with the desire to join hands with the whole province to soon push back the epidemic.

Mr. Le Van Hong and Mrs. Nguyen Thi Minh, owners of Minh Hong restaurant in Le Loi ward, Vinh city, provided 2,500 free meals to the anti-epidemic force; the young couple Nguyen Thanh Hai (born in 1987) and his wife Nguyen Thi Huyen Trang (born in 1991), owners of Tre Viet restaurant in Ha Huy Tap ward, Vinh city, chose to turn the restaurant into a kitchen to cook free meals for the frontline force. Mr. Vu Thai Quang in Vinh city mobilized businesses to transport air-conditioned office containers to checkpoints and epidemic control stations on national highways entering and exiting Vinh city to serve as resting places for officers and soldiers after each shift change at the checkpoint...

In recent days, many businesses, organizations, agencies, units and individuals in the province have actively participated and donated. After the Provincial Fatherland Front Committee called for support for Covid-19 prevention and control, the whole province has so far donated more than 54 billion VND (of which, the total amount is more than 48 billion VND, goods worth nearly 6 billion VND). In addition, the Fatherland Front Committees of Nghi Loc, Dien Chau, Quynh Luu, Thai Hoa, Nam Dan districts... receive a lot of necessities from the people every day to support and contribute to the functional forces on the front line of epidemic prevention and control.
